    JACC requests feedback on proposed temporary restricted areas (TRAs) and procedures for TRA ‘NIMBUS’ and TRA ‘CIRRUS’.

    The issue

    This proposal notes the following key issues:
    • Conditional status of TRAs west of RAAF Amberley will be RA2.
    • Multiple air routes affected. Diversion routes to be published in AIP SUPP.
    • Access to TRA is limited to exercise participates, aircraft with a declared emergency or undertaking operations in the preservation of life and/or property.

    Purpose

    Elements of the Royal Australian Air Force (RAAF) will be conducting training exercises in the last week of November 2026.

    Two Temporary Restricted Areas (TRAs) are proposed to safely separate civil aircraft from fast jet activities over the period 23-27 November 2026.

    Proposal

    Two TRAs are proposed to support fast jet operations out of RAAF Amberley, Qld. Indicative timings are listed in Table 1, with specific activation timings to be promulgated by AIP SUP and NOTAM. 

    Airspace Date Time 

    TRA ‘NIMBUS’ 23 – 27 November 2026 0200Z – 14000Z Daily 
    (1200 Local – 2359 Local) 

    TRA ‘CIRRUS’ 23 – 27 November 2026 0200Z – 08000Z Daily
    (1200 Local – 1800 Local) 

    Diversion Routes

    This airspace proposal has an effect on ATS routes passing west of Brisbane, Qld. Diversion routing will be required during the periods of temporary airspace activation. Diversion routes will be developed in consultation with Airservices Australia, and shall be published in the AIP SUP.

    Access to TRA ‘NIMBUS’ and TRA ‘CIRRUS’

    During NOTAM activation periods, access to TRA ‘NIMBUS’ and TRA’CIRRUS’ by non-exercise aircraft will not be available except in cases of a declared emergency, radio failure or participating in activities for the preservation of life and property (SAR, MED, POL or FFR). 

    YBBB/TRA ‘NIMBUS’
    Conditional Status: RA2
    Military Flying 
    Lateral Limits: 265722S 1485538E – 265738S 1494403E – 281000S 1494800E – 291542S 1500721E – 291523S 1492858E – 285713S 1485340E – 265722S 1485538E
    Vertical Limits: 10 000 – FL600 
    Hours of Activity: NOTAM
    Controlling Authority: 452SQN Amberley Flight Commander 

    YBBB/TRA ‘CIRRUS’
    Conditional Status: RA2
    Military Flying 
    Lateral Limits: 265722S 1475000E – 265722S 1485538E – 285713S 1485340E 291523S 1492858E – 291523S 1475835E – 290928S 1475000E – 265722S 1475000E 
    Vertical Limits: 10 000 – FL600 
    Hours of Activity: NOTAM 
    Controlling Authority: 452SQN Amberley Flight Commander
